# 17  
Old 04-02-2010
Quote:
Originally Posted by lego
solved! i did:

Code:
let lc=1
while [ $lc -lt 100 ]; do
awk 'NR%100==lc' lc=$lc input >> output
let lc=$lc+1
done

Instead of invoking awk 99 times this should be a better approach :
Code:
awk '{ print; z=substr($0,1,1); n=substr($0,2)
  for(i=10;i<1000;i+=10){
    printf("%s%d%s\n", z, i, n)
  }
}' input > output
